    Thank you guys for all the great ideas. This is how I am eating my oatmeal this morning:

    1/2 cup Quakers quick oats
    1 cup unsweetened almond milk
    1 scoop Publix Chocolate whey protein powder
    1/4 cup chopped walnut and 8 almonds.
    1/4 cup chia seeds

    It tastes okay, cant say great.

    I just read an article on Slate about oatmeal. I don't know if you are familiar with their your'e doing it wrong recipes, but they just did one for oatmeal.
    Oatmeal With Sautéed Apples
    Yield: 2 or 3 servings
    Time: 15 minutes

    2 tablespoons unsalted butter
    4 medium apples, thinly sliced
    Salt
    1½ cups rolled oats
    1½ cups milk
    ½ teaspoon ground cinnamon
    ½ teaspoon vanilla extract
    2 tablespoons brown sugar, plus more for serving

    1. Put the butter in a large skillet over medium-high heat. When it melts, add the apples and a pinch of salt, and cook, stirring occasionally, until tender and lightly browned, about 10 minutes.

    2. Meanwhile, put the oats, milk, and cinnamon in a medium pot with a pinch of salt and 1½ cups water. Bring to a boil over medium-high heat, then reduce the heat to low and cook, stirring occasionally, until the oats are tender and the mixture is creamy and thick, 5 to 7 minutes. Turn off the heat, and stir in the vanilla.

    3. When the apples are tender, add the 2 tablespoons brown sugar and stir just until it melts, about 1 minute. Serve the oatmeal topped with the apples and additional brown sugar, if you like.
